SIC8833芯片开发厨房电子秤方案

2024-03-08 18:18

本文主要是介绍SIC8833芯片开发厨房电子秤方案,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

  针对高精度电子秤的市场匮乏,我司开发了一款5KG量程,0.1g分度值的厨房电子秤,该方案主控芯片采用SIC8833 QFN32,是一个8位RISC架构的高性能单片机,集成了24Bit高精度ADC和LCD/LED显示模块,接下来一起来看看该电子秤方案参数。
  
  一、 设计说明
  
  1、 采用SIC8833芯片开发;
  
  2、 自动调零 和 2 段自动标定。
  
  3、 USB 充电功能 (3V 供电时无此功能)
  
  二、 主要特性/技术指标
  
  1、 量程:5KG
  
  2、 分度值: 0.1g
  
  3、 单位及模式转换:
  
  模式转换:按 MODE 键,重量模式→水体积模式→牛奶体积模式,顺序转换。
  
  单位转换:按 UNIT 键,公制→英制,顺序转换。
  
  4、 即公制模式下,按 MODE 键 g→ml(水)→ml(牛奶),顺序转换;
  
  5、 英制模式下,按 MODE 键 lb:oz→floz(水) →floz(牛奶)。
  
  三、 软件操作与提示
  
  1、按键说明:
  
  1) ON/OFF/zero 键:开/关机/清零/去皮键,按此键实现开机或者长按关机功能,开机后。
  
  当重量大于 200g 时,按键为去皮功能,显示符号“T”,否则为清零功能,显示符号“o”。
  
  2) MODE 键:模式转换键,实现重量模式→水体积模式→牛奶体积模式之间的转换。
  
  3) UNIT 键:单位转换键,实现公制→英制单位转换。
  
  四、 功能操作
  
  1、 称重操作:
  
  关机状态下,按一次 ON/OFF/zero 键,秤即开机显示,进入扫零点状态,此时等待约 3 秒(具体时间视秤盘稳定程度),扫零成功显示相应单位界面。此时方可以加载重量称重。
  
  2、 模式及单位转换功能:
  
  称重模式下,按 MODE 按键,重量模式→水体积模式→牛奶体积模式之间的转换。
  
  3、 清零/去皮操作:
  
  清零/去皮以 200g 为分界点,开机归零后,先往秤盘加载一较小重量,如 64g,稳定后按ON/OFF/zero 键,则清零功能生效;加载 1000g,稳定后按 ON/OFF/zero 键,则去皮功能生效,去皮功能生效时,若再次按 ON/OFF/zero 键,则可查看原值。
  
  4、 标定操作:
  
  关机状态下先按住 mode 键,然后按 ON/OFF/zero 开机,松开一次 ON/OFF/zero 键再按住 ON/OFF/zero 键,进入标定模式。显示 “C-X”,X 表示剩余标定次数。 松开 ON/OFF/zero 键,秤体先自动扫零,并显示内码。当零点稳定之后,自动开始第一段标定,显示。加载 2000g,显示动态内码值,稳定后进入第二段标定,显示加载 5000g,显示动态内码值,稳定后标定完成短时显示“F”,然后自动检测当前砝码重量。
  
  五、 错误提示符:
  
  (1) 、LO:表示电压低;
  
  (2) 、Err:表示超载。

 

 

这篇关于SIC8833芯片开发厨房电子秤方案的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!


原文地址:
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.chinasem.cn/article/787964

相关文章

Python实战之SEO优化自动化工具开发指南

《Python实战之SEO优化自动化工具开发指南》在数字化营销时代,搜索引擎优化(SEO)已成为网站获取流量的重要手段,本文将带您使用Python开发一套完整的SEO自动化工具,需要的可以了解下... 目录前言项目概述技术栈选择核心模块实现1. 关键词研究模块2. 网站技术seo检测模块3. 内容优化分析模

基于Java开发一个极简版敏感词检测工具

《基于Java开发一个极简版敏感词检测工具》这篇文章主要为大家详细介绍了如何基于Java开发一个极简版敏感词检测工具,文中的示例代码简洁易懂,感兴趣的小伙伴可以跟随小编一起学习一下... 目录你是否还在为敏感词检测头疼一、极简版Java敏感词检测工具的3大核心优势1.1 优势1:DFA算法驱动,效率提升10

Python多线程应用中的卡死问题优化方案指南

《Python多线程应用中的卡死问题优化方案指南》在利用Python语言开发某查询软件时,遇到了点击搜索按钮后软件卡死的问题,本文将简单分析一下出现的原因以及对应的优化方案,希望对大家有所帮助... 目录问题描述优化方案1. 网络请求优化2. 多线程架构优化3. 全局异常处理4. 配置管理优化优化效果1.

Python开发简易网络服务器的示例详解(新手入门)

《Python开发简易网络服务器的示例详解(新手入门)》网络服务器是互联网基础设施的核心组件,它本质上是一个持续运行的程序,负责监听特定端口,本文将使用Python开发一个简单的网络服务器,感兴趣的小... 目录网络服务器基础概念python内置服务器模块1. HTTP服务器模块2. Socket服务器模块

MySQL容灾备份的实现方案

《MySQL容灾备份的实现方案》进行MySQL的容灾备份是确保数据安全和业务连续性的关键步骤,容灾备份可以分为本地备份和远程备份,主要包括逻辑备份和物理备份两种方式,下面就来具体介绍一下... 目录一、逻辑备份1. 使用mysqldump进行逻辑备份1.1 全库备份1.2 单库备份1.3 单表备份2. 恢复

Java 与 LibreOffice 集成开发指南(环境搭建及代码示例)

《Java与LibreOffice集成开发指南(环境搭建及代码示例)》本文介绍Java与LibreOffice的集成方法,涵盖环境配置、API调用、文档转换、UNO桥接及REST接口等技术,提供... 目录1. 引言2. 环境搭建2.1 安装 LibreOffice2.2 配置 Java 开发环境2.3 配

redis中session会话共享的三种方案

《redis中session会话共享的三种方案》本文探讨了分布式系统中Session共享的三种解决方案,包括粘性会话、Session复制以及基于Redis的集中存储,具有一定的参考价值,感兴趣的可以了... 目录三种解决方案粘性会话(Sticky Sessions)Session复制Redis统一存储Spr

SpringBoot实现虚拟线程的方案

《SpringBoot实现虚拟线程的方案》Java19引入虚拟线程,本文就来介绍一下SpringBoot实现虚拟线程的方案,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,... 目录什么是虚拟线程虚拟线程和普通线程的区别SpringBoot使用虚拟线程配置@Async性能对比H

MySQL中读写分离方案对比分析与选型建议

《MySQL中读写分离方案对比分析与选型建议》MySQL读写分离是提升数据库可用性和性能的常见手段,本文将围绕现实生产环境中常见的几种读写分离模式进行系统对比,希望对大家有所帮助... 目录一、问题背景介绍二、多种解决方案对比2.1 原生mysql主从复制2.2 Proxy层中间件:ProxySQL2.3

Python38个游戏开发库整理汇总

《Python38个游戏开发库整理汇总》文章介绍了多种Python游戏开发库,涵盖2D/3D游戏开发、多人游戏框架及视觉小说引擎,适合不同需求的开发者入门,强调跨平台支持与易用性,并鼓励读者交流反馈以... 目录PyGameCocos2dPySoyPyOgrepygletPanda3DBlenderFife